The assessment and valuation of the Weld County Assessor was affirmed as follows: ACTUAL VALUE AS DETERMINED BY ASSESSOR ACTUAL VALUE AS SET BY BOARD $363,598 $363,598 2009-1814 AS0073 (76i' /IS; (',7t /ki(Lt772-:Xl c'io 7 WARE MERLE - R0238495 Page 2 A denial of a petition, in whole or in part, by the Board of Equalization may be appealed by selecting one of the following three options; however, said appeal must be filed within 30 days of the denial: 1. Board of Assessment Appeals: You have the right to appeal the County Board of Equalization's (CBOE's) decision to the Board of Assessment Appeals (BAA). Such hearing is the final hearing at which testimony, exhibits, or any other evidence may be introduced. If the decision of the BAA is further appealed to the Court of Appeals only the record created at the BAA hearing shall be the basis for the Court's decision. No new evidence can be introduced at the Court of Appeals. (Section 39-8-108(10), C.R.S.) Appeals to the BAA must be made on forms furnished by the BAA, and such appeals should be mailed or delivered within thirty (30) days of denial by the CBOE to: Board of Assessment Appeals 1313 Sherman Street, Room 315 Denver, CO 80203 Phone: 303-866-5880 Fees: A taxpayer representing himself is not charged for the first two appeals to the Board of Assessment Appeals; however, a taxpayer being represented by an agent or an attorney must submit a fee of $101.25 per appeal. OR 2. District Court: You have the right to appeal the CBOE's decision to the District Court of the county wherein your property is located. New testimony, exhibits or any other evidence may be introduced at the District Court hearing. For filing requirements, please contact your attorney or the Clerk of the District Court. Further appeal of the District Court's decision is made to the Court of Appeals for a review of the record. (Section 39-8-108(1), C.R.S.) OR 3. Binding Arbitration: You have the right to submit your case to arbitration. If you choose this option the arbitrator's decision is final and your right to appeal your current valuation ends. (Section 39-8-108.5, C.R.S.) Selecting the Arbitrator: In order to pursue arbitration, you must notify the CBOE of your intent. You and the CBOE select an arbitrator from the official list of qualified people. If you cannot agree on an arbitrator, the District Court of the county in which the property is located will make the selection. Arbitration Hearing Procedure: Arbitration hearings are held within sixty days from the date the arbitrator is selected. Both you and the CBOE are entitled to participate. The hearings are informal. The arbitrator has the authority to issue subpoenas for witnesses, books, records, documents and other evidence. He 2009-1814 AS0073 WARE MERLE - R0238495 Page 3 also has the power to administer oaths, and all questions of law and fact shall be determined by him. The arbitration hearing may be confidential and closed to the public, upon mutual agreement. The arbitrator's written decision must be delivered to both parties personally or by registered mail within ten (10) days of the hearing. Such decision is final and not subject to review. Fees and Expenses: The arbitrator's fees and expenses are agreed upon by you and the CBOE. In the case of residential real property, such fees and expenses cannot exceed $150.00 per case. The arbitrator's fees and expenses, not including counsel fees, are to be paid as provided in the decision. CBOE_RES_01i Pac MARKET APPROACH SUMMARY Real property for the tax year 2009 must be valued utilizing the level of value for the period of one and one-half years immediately prior to July 1, 2008. A period of five years immediately prior to July 1, 2008 shall be utilized to determine the level of value if adequate data is not available from such one and one-half year period to adequately determine the level of value for a class of property. Said level of value shall be adjusted to the final day of the data -gathering period. Changes occurring between base years are not to be accounted for until the following level of value is implemented, other than additions, change in use, detrimental acts of nature, damage due to fire, etc., creation of a condominium, new regulations restricting or increasing the use of the land, or a combination thereof {39-1-104(11)(b)(I), CRS}. The Weld County Assessor has an established ongoing Sales Confirmation and Validation Program for property transactions used in developing values. The subject property has been classified as Residential for assessment purposes. Residential property value shall be determined by appropriate consideration of the Market Approach to Value {39-1-103(5)(a), CRS}. The deadline for filing real property appeals is July 15. The deadline for filing personal property appeals is July 20. The Assessor establishes property values. The local taxing authorities (county, school district, city, tire protection, and other special districts) set mill levies. The mill levy requested by each taxing authority is based on a projected budget and the property tax revenue required to adequately fund the services it provides to its taxpayers. The local taxing authorities hold budget hearings in the fall. If you are concerned about mill levies, we recommend that you attend these budget hearings. The County Board of Equalization must mail a written decision to you within five business days following the date of the decision. The County Board of Equalization must conclude hearings and render decisions by August 5, § 39-8-107(2), C.R.S. If you do not receive a decision from the County Board of Equalization and you wish to continue your appeal, you must file an appeal with the Board of Assessment Appeals by September 11. (d a e2L- Li`��S J if ki,-Xl`j2c:v< C,ti/T/1 /Ye -4K°7- (-; *cf./ 5 /).97-5 / /21/i/;KC 7/, 3 A. et Fellow Willow Springs Homeowners: I'm protesting my 2009 property tax NOV (Notice of Valuation). Looking through our subdivision's records (on the Weld County site), the valuation of most everyone's Improvements (i.e. your homes and outbuildings) have gone down since the 2007 NOV. Given the state of the housing market in the last two years, that's as it should be. However, for the most part, our Total Value has increased. How did that happen? Weld County increased the Valuation of our Land by 69.49 %! How they came up with that figure, I have no idea, especially since one of the comparable homes in Weld County I cited, only showed an increase in Land value of 19.65 % between 2007 and 2009. That's one of the issues I'm contesting. My contention is that the Land value associated with our location has decreased, not increased, since 2007's NOV. As I stated in my protest: DEPRECIATION OF LAND VALUE The 2007 N.O.V. valued the Land for the subject property at $88500. This assessment was based on market data from January 2005, through June 2006. A major factor of Land value stems from its location, coinciding with what encompasses the surrounding area. In the Fall of 2005, the Owens/Illinois bottling plant began operation in what is commonly known as the Windsor Industrial Park In the Fall of 2006, Front Range Energy began the operation of its ethanol production plant in the same Industrial Park In mid -2008, Vestas Wind Products began building its plant in Windsor Industrial Park The value of Willow Springs Estates' location has depreciated since the 2007 N.O. V What used to be a quiet agricultural enclave, strategically situated to nearby Windsor, has become a subdivision bordering an industrial area, with all the pitfalls and aggravations associated with such a location.... Views: 20 1 of 1 7/7/2009 11:2 5.1 CALCULATE TAXES OWED If you believe the actual value of your home is too high and determine that you want to proceed with a protest of that value, follow the instructions and complete the protest forms in the chapters listed below. 5.2 OBTAIN INFORMATION FROM ASSESSOR If you want to proceed with a protest, you should first contact the assessor in the county where your home is located, and _request all the _data he used in determining the actual value of your home. The assessor is required by statute to provide ouy with this information. C.R.S. 39-5-121.5. The assessor should provide you with a data sheet (referred to in some counties as an Inventory Content Sheet) that sets forth the assessor's description and condition of your property as of January 1st of the applicable tax year (See Exhibit 6-1; See Section 6.2). The assessor should also provide you with a list of the sales of comparable homes he used and the adjustments he made to those sales in determining the value of your home under the market approach (See Exhibit 9-1; See Section 9.2). 5.3 PREPARING PROTEST/USE OF FORMS The purpose of your protest is to determine the correct value of your home and to show that the assessor's value is incorrect. The following chapters provide procedures that can be followed to achieve this goal. You may use all of the arguments in the following chapters and all the forms in Appendix 6, or you may select only those that are applicable to your situation. The chapters listed below describe in detail the procedures of preparing your protest. The following is an overview. 1. Check Assessors Data (Chapter 6) In Chapter 6, you will check the data used by the assessor in determining the value of your home. You will report any errors in the assessor's description of your home and record any problems due to the condition of your home. Because of the volume of cases before the Board of Equalization, all cases shall be limited to 15 minutes. Also due to volume, cases cannot be rescheduled. It is imperative that you provide evidence to support your position. This may include evidence that similar homes in your area are valued less than yours or you are being assessed on improvements you do not have. Please note: The fact that your valuation has increased cannot be your sole basis of appeal. Without documented evidence as indicated above, the Board will have no choice but to deny your appeal. If you wish to obtain the data supporting the Assessor's valuation of your property, please submit a written request directly to the Assessor's Office by fax (970) 304-6433, or if you have questions, call (970) 353-3845. Upon receipt of your written request, the Assessor will notify you of the estimated cost of providing such information. Payment must be made prior to the Assessor providing such information, at which time the Assessor will make the data available within three (3) working days, subject to any confidentiality requirements.
